React developers use icons everywhere: navigation menus, dashboards, buttons, settings panels, notifications, forms, onboarding flows, documentation, marketing pages, and mobile apps.
But choosing the right icon library is not always easy.
Some libraries are minimal and clean. Others are better for enterprise dashboards, design systems, or marketing websites. Performance, SVG quality, React integration, consistency, and customization also matter.
Here are some of the best SVG icon libraries for React developers in 2026, along with their strengths, weaknesses, and ideal use cases.
Why SVG Icons Matter in React
SVG icons have become the standard for modern React applications because they are:
- lightweight
- scalable
- customizable with CSS
- easy to theme
- accessible
- compatible with dark mode
- ideal for responsive interfaces
Compared to icon fonts, SVG icons provide cleaner rendering and better control.
Most modern React UI frameworks now rely entirely on SVG.
1. Heroicons
Heroicons were created specifically for modern UI applications.
Heroicons are:
- clean
- minimal
- consistent
- excellent for SaaS dashboards
- perfect with Tailwind CSS
They are available in outline and solid styles.
Best for:
- Tailwind projects
- admin dashboards
- startup interfaces
- clean modern UIs
Pros:
- beautiful consistency
- optimized SVGs
- official React package
- easy customization
Cons:
- limited stylistic variety
- sometimes too minimalist for branding-heavy apps
Official website: https://heroicons.com
2. Lucide
Lucide has become extremely popular among React developers.
It is a community-driven fork of Feather Icons with:
- more icons
- better maintenance
- modern consistency
- excellent TypeScript support
Lucide works especially well in:
- developer tools
- productivity apps
- AI dashboards
- modern web applications
Pros:
- huge growing library
- lightweight
- excellent React integration
- tree-shakable packages
Cons:
- mostly outline style
- less suitable for highly decorative interfaces
Official website: https://lucide.dev
3. Tabler Icons
Tabler Icons are highly appreciated for their balance between clarity and personality.
They are:
- slightly more expressive than Heroicons
- very readable
- excellent for dashboards and data-heavy apps
Pros:
- large collection
- consistent stroke design
- React package available
- visually distinctive without being distracting
Cons:
- outline-focused style
- some icons can feel visually busy at small sizes
Official website: https://tabler.io/icons
4. Phosphor Icons
Phosphor is one of the most flexible icon systems available today.
It includes:
- thin
- light
- regular
- bold
- fill
- duotone styles
This makes it excellent for:
- complex design systems
- apps needing multiple visual weights
- highly customizable interfaces
Pros:
- multiple visual styles
- very flexible
- strong React support
- excellent visual quality
Cons:
- larger design surface
- requires stronger design consistency decisions
Official website: https://phosphoricons.com
5. Remix Icon
Remix Icon offers a very large set of icons covering many use cases.
Best for:
- enterprise applications
- admin panels
- content-heavy platforms
- apps needing uncommon icons
Pros:
- extensive coverage
- solid + outline variants
- easy to use
- consistent structure
Cons:
- style may feel less unique
- some icons are less refined than premium-focused libraries
Official website: https://remixicon.com
6. Material Symbols
Material Symbols are the evolution of Material Icons.
These icons are ideal for:
- Android-style apps
- enterprise software
- Google ecosystem products
Pros:
- huge ecosystem
- variable icon technology
- excellent accessibility
- very mature system
Cons:
- recognizable Google aesthetic
- less unique branding feel
Official website: https://fonts.google.com/icons
How to Choose the Right Icon Library
The best choice depends on your product.
| Use Case | Recommended Library |
|---|---|
| SaaS dashboard | Heroicons |
| Developer tools | Lucide |
| Enterprise admin panel | Tabler Icons |
| Flexible design systems | Phosphor |
| Large feature coverage | Remix Icon |
| Android / Material UI | Material Symbols |
Search Multiple SVG Icon Libraries Faster
One common problem for developers is having to browse multiple icon libraries separately.
When building interfaces, developers often compare:
- styles
- stroke thickness
- readability
- consistency
- React compatibility
Instead of opening many different websites manually, using an SVG icon search engine can significantly speed up the workflow.
For example, SVGicons allows developers to search and compare icons across multiple libraries from a single interface:
https://svgicons.com/svg-icon-search-engine
This is especially useful when:
- building dashboards
- prototyping quickly
- maintaining design consistency
- searching alternative icon styles
Final Thoughts
There is no single βbestβ SVG icon library for every React project.
The best approach is usually:
- choose one primary library,
- stay visually consistent,
- optimize SVG usage,
- avoid mixing unrelated styles excessively.
Modern React applications depend heavily on clean UI systems, and icons are a critical part of that experience.
Choosing the right SVG icon library can improve:
- usability,
- development speed,
- visual consistency,
- and overall product quality.
Top comments (0)